UV/visible spectroscopy involves measuring the absorption of ultraviolet or visible mild by molecules. It utilizes light from the wavelength choice of two hundred-800 nm. The important thing components of a UV-visible spectrophotometer are a lightweight supply, wavelength selector like a monochromator, sample holder, detector, and linked electronics.

Sample Container: The sample container or cuvette retains the sample by which The sunshine passes. There are 2 types of spectrophotometers depending on how they deal with The sunshine beam: one-beam and double-beam. In one-beam spectrophotometer, all light-weight passes in the sample, even though in a very double-beam spectrophotometer, The sunshine is split into two paths – 1 passes with the sample and another via a reference.
